Introducing the Opportunity & Empowerment Award (new for 2020)
Modeled after the HUD Secretary's Empowerment Award at the APA National Level, this award seeks to recognize the hard work done to elevate, empower, and improve the visibility and agency of low and moderate income individuals. APA-IL seeks to recognize the achievements made across Illinois that empower and give agency to economically disadvantaged communities, including communities of color, which are too often denied the resources and voice necessary to correct for generations of systemic neglect, disinvestment, racism, and violence. We urge our statewide membership to seek out, nominate, and celebrate the hard work being done in these communities, by planners of color, and to those providing planning in creative and different ways that challenge the status quo.
